Лёха смог: уйти из Мака в 35 лет и стать программистом
Статью заказал сам Лёха. Он – отличный парень, но пока немного не уверен в своём умении доходчиво выражать мысли. Однако, мне понравилась цель его заказа, поэтому я решил поучаствовать – написать текст от его имени. Итак, Лёха смог войти в айти. В 35 лет, ни дня до того не проработав программистом. Зато оттрубив 10+ лет в Маке. Магия цифр: приходя в АйТи, Лёха зарабатывал 35 тыщ. Спустя полтора года – сотку. Дальнейший рост предвидится – Лёха идёт по известной шкале, конец которой ещё далеко. Пока обозримая цифра – две сотки. Да, цель-то, которую Лёха сформулировал… «Парни, всё получится!».
Коротко о Лёхе
Долго рассусоливать не буду, ибо секретов у Лёхи не так много. При этом, есть с кем сравнить – параллельно с ним возникали, пыхтели, тужились и куда-то исчезали примерно такие же парни. Возраст, образование, даже количество детей – всё один в один. Но остался только Лёха. Образование у Лёхи – профильное. Точнее – «профильное», ибо учился он в одном из ВУЗов-шарашек, коих в нулевые развелось, как грибов после дождя (сорян, Лёха). Но формально он учился на программиста. Неглубоко – паскаль, дельфи. Потом занесла нелёгкая. Да, вдруг это важно: Лёха подался в 1С. Не по любви – просто там требования ниже и вполне себе есть места, куда можно устроиться без опыта, учиться и даже некоторое время получать стипендию.
Коротко о начале карьеры в 1С
В 1С для начинающих сейчас три пути: плохой, плохой и программист. Лёха пару раз чуть не сорвался на первый и второй, но удержался на истинном, поэтому сотка с перспективой. Первый плохой путь – стать чучелом одного из распространённых в 1С видов. Обычно это «слесарь» или «аналитик». Как вам объяснить-то, вы ж не из 1С… Представьте, что работаете в компании, продающей MS Word (ну или весь пакет MS Office). Так вот, если вы умеете устанавливать Ворд, и способны обучить пользователя в нём работать – вы слесарь. Жирным выделить, таблицу добавить, разрыв страницы – всё ваша стезя. Для солидности называете себя «программист». Если же вы способны решить задачу «сделайте мне, чтобы первая страница была Портрет, а вторая – Альбом», то вы – аналитик. Примерно так. Второй плохой путь в 1С – специализация. Например, стать Большим Мастером Диаграмм в PowerPoint. Знать и рисовать их лучше всех. Уметь выводить в диаграмму данные из внешнего источника (того же файла Excel или MySQL). Сделать взаимозависимые диаграммы на одном слайде. Ну и т.д. Это в 1С называется «специалист по конфигурации». Порадуемся – Лёха всего этого избежал. Плохой и плохой путь схожи в том, что их легко постичь, легко поднять первые деньги, но также легко достичь потолка, который болтается где-то в районе 60-80. А дальше никак – спрос невелик. Лёха пошёл по стезе программиста 1С – это который решает любые задачи. Ну, не так пафосно, всё-таки полтора года ещё… Берётся за любые задачи. И, при должном усердии, помощи хорошей команды и мотивированного наставника – всё получается.
Каменная задница
Главная фишка Лёхи – «каменная задница». Он не сам это придумал – говорит, такой была внутрипартийная кличка товарища Молотова (который Вячеслав Михайлович, глава советского МИД времён ВОВ). Лёха брал крепость измором. Путь не был усыпан розами – поначалу вообще ни хрена не получалось. Вот прям вообще. Базовые какие-то алгоритмы помнил, даже что-то из дельфи (кстати, 1С в части рисования форм, событий и прочего «визуального» на неё сильно похожа). Но решать реальные задачи долго не получалось. На этом моменте – переходе от учебных задач к реальным – сыпались почти все такие же, как Лёха. Сидели с 9 до 18, потом вставали и уходили. Утром возвращались – а воз был и ныне там. А Лёха не уходил – сидел, как минимум, до 20:00. Ещё дома досиживал. Спокойно, без истерик. Ну, по крайней мере, внешне. И стало получаться. Да, с дичайшей эффективностью – решать 20 часов задачу, которую положено шваркнуть за 1 час. Но стало получаться! И, как ни странно, появилось и проявилось качество, за которое Лёху очень быстро стали ценить начальство и клиенты: надёжность. Редкое, кстати, качество. Надёжность в том, что Лёха точно досидит и найдёт решение. Да, неэффективно, долго, ужасно, но… Найдёт. Совершенно точно.
Как дитё малое
Вторая, не менее важная фишка Лёхи – думаю, врождённая или где-то давно приобретённая (в Маке?). Лёха совершенно не боится ляпнуть чушь. Вот вообще. Или настолько искусно скрывает, что даже тени подозрения не возникает. В работе начинающих программистов 1С надо много разговаривать с клиентами – это часть процесса обучения, увы. Обычно начинающий программист готовится к звонку несколько часов, а то и дней. Тщательно продумывает слова, вопросы, сценарии. Некоторые не выдерживают напряжения и увольняются, так и не совершив свой первый звонок. А Лёха просто берёт и звонит. Знает тему, не знает – пофигу. Не пытается казаться умным, вежливым или клиентоориентированным – просто сухо, по делу, просит показать, что случилось и какая нужна помощь. Не всегда понимает, что ему говорят – тут выручает видеозапись. Эта же фишка помогает Лёхе в общении с более опытными товарищами. Даже с теми, которые окутывают себя ореолом профессиональной загадочности («на хромой кобыле не подъедешь»). Лёха и тут не боится спрашивать чушь. И эта, почти детская, его непосредственность подкупает всех. Никому в голову не приходит самоутверждаться за счёт Лёхи (за счёт других – только дым стоит). И Лёхе всегда помогут.
Форрест Гамп
Третья – моя любимая – фишка Лёхи: он не перестаёт учиться. У них там есть несколько программ, или потоков обучения. На первых порах у Лёхи была обязаловка – всякие базовые штуки учить, вроде конструкций языка, универсальных коллекций, запросов и т.д. Тут Лёха вёл себя, как Форрест Гамп: надо – значит надо. Потом началась необязательная программа – куча тем для самостоятельного изучения. Хочешь – зубри, вникай, сдавай экзамен. Сдашь – будешь чутка больше получать. Сдашь много – будешь сильно больше получать. Так вот, Лёха за год прошёл то, что другие мучали 2-3 года. Каменная задница. Сейчас, по прошествии полутора лет, Лёха опять ввязался в какое-то внутреннее обучение. За него уже не доплачивают впрямую – чисто профессиональный рост, который потом ещё надо как-то продать своему же руководству. Так Лёха и сюда вписался. Что-то вроде глубокой индивидуальной прокачки – наставник определяет слабые места в твоём программировании, и целенаправленно помогает их прокачать. Эта прокачка – в нерабочее, личное время. На работе работай, а вечером – сиди, решай задачи по своей слабой теме. Лёха сидит, пыхтит, решает.
Резюме
Собственно, всё. Как видите, никаких откровений, супер-пупер-фишек, мегакрутых курсов и наставников от Бога. Никаких особых способностей у Лёхи нет – ну, или пока не проявились. Самый обычный парень, но в АйТи войти смог – уже после кризиса среднего возраста. Я тут не ageism развожу – мне самому под 40. Потому и знаю, на своём опыте, насколько охренеть как трудно в таком возрасте радикально менять область деятельности. Ну и, благодаря Лёхе, могу составить драфт из трёх качеств, которые точно лишними на этом пути не будут. Каменная задница, исполнительность и непосредственность. Да, а те, кто свалил – увы, этими качествами не обладали. Думали, что переучиться на программиста можно за рабочий день. Стеснялись выглядеть глупыми («пока вопросов нет, вникаю» — и так по несколько дней). Избегали любой учёбы, кроме обязательной («меня же всему научат»). Поглядим, что будет дальше. Интересно же.
Очень трудно изучить программирование 1С?
Все выше высказавшиеся по своему правы:
1)надо иметь способности к программированию, без них надо менять деятельность
2)в виду того что 1С-программирование сложно, потому что заточено под реальную человеческую деятельность, которая у нас заключается «в 2 пишем 3 в уме», приходится в нем напрягаться
3)в 1с-разработке приходится плотно общаться с конечными пользователями, нервными тетками задерганными начальством с одной стороны и налоговиками и другими проверяющими с другой стороны а с третьей — их дергают клиенты и поставщики. Клиентам надо доки сразу, а за поставщиками надо бегать выпрашивая от них бух. доки, а при этом данные должны УЖЕ находиться в 1С-проге. А с 4-й стороны плановики требуют каких-то будущих цифр с проги 1С
4)В русском языке есть слова РЕАЛЬНАЯ ЖИЗНЬ которую не запихаешь в операторы ветвления и циклов. Потому что для начальства надо показать правду, налоговикам надо показать убытки, кредиторам (банкам) надо показать головокружительный успех и стабильность и эти все цифирьки должны вылезти все из одной и той же 1С-базы
5)А также есть пользователи для которых не существует ни инструкций, не кнопки F1 не существует гугла, а есть только телефонный номер 1С-программиста по которому можно сказать: ПРИЕЗЖАЙТЕ СРОЧНО, ВАША ГРЕБАННАЯ ПРОГРАММА НЕ РАБОТАЕТ)) )
6)любая современная система программирования это конструктор ЛЕГО, и каждая из них меняется не реже чем 1С, посмотрите на ту же винду а по несколько обновлений в месяц. А посмотрите на winmobile и попробуйте программировать под WM5 в VS2010 и наоборот напишите прогу для winphone7 в VS2008, и это при том что для мобильников пишут простейшие календарики и тетрисы, вот вам и совместимость
7) про бабки тоже верно СПЕЦИАЛИСТ в любой области а не только в 1С получает БАБКИ
резюме: стало быть надо в жизни найти занятие по душе, стать в нем специалистом и тогда будет и бабки, и признание и авторитет и довольство в жизни.
От человека зависит.
Для меня это оказалось непосильной задачей и я иду служить нашему доблесному отечеству, а кто-то даже не ходя на пары все понимает.
для кого как по видео урокам не трудно а через спец программы или по книжке сложновато особенно по книге
ха, 50 000-150 000 в Хабаровске. Зависит от того насколько много хозяин ворует у своих сотрудников и государства и сколько много денег надо скрыть от налоговой
1С является по сути своей конструктором Лего! В готовой конфигурации разбираться достаточно просто, а вот если ты пишешь конфу под пользователя, то это ж.. а! Я даже один раз видел мордобой межу двумя 1С программерами из за конфы (доспорились ребята) . В догонку могу сказать, что программирование очень сильно отличается от версии к версии.
Первую простейшую програмку уже через час сбацать можно, если компилятор нормальный есть.
А дальше начинаются дебри.
Компиляторы ни хрена не одинаковые, и текст который прекрасно работал у соседа у меня вдруг отказывается компилироваться.
Я думаю, что это одно из самых нудных и геморройных занятий. В готовом то продукте 1с черт голову сломит, как все не удобно сделано. Ради одной простейшей операции вычисления какой-нибудь херни, нужно зайти в тысячу меню и подменю с таблицами, вбить туда десяток параметров с константами и в конечном итоге все это не будет работать по неизвестной никому причине.. . хотя все сделано по правилам. и начинается монотонное тыкание по всем однообразным пунктам меню, все сначала. В русском языке есть хлесткое подходящее слово для всего этого — мозгоёбство.